I purchased this to replace the 4-pronged cable that the dryer I purchased had. It took about four minutes to remove the old cable and install this one. It was super easy and quick, even for a beginner.To Install:Remove the old cable.Connect the two outside wires to the red and black wires (doesn't matter which one you connect to. Both are hot and work the same).Connect the middle wire the the white wire (this one does matter. The middle wire is neutral and needs to go to the middle/white wire on the dryer).Replace the backing.Test to make sure it works.

Works well as an EVSE adapter cord
I used this cord along with a Leviton 2323 20 Amp, 250 Volt, NEMA L6-20R, 2P, 3W, Locking Connector, Industrial Grade, Grounding - Black-White to make an adapter cable for my Clipper Creek LCS-25 EVSE. I used it last week to charge my Volt at my parents house with no trouble at all. After ~4 hours of charging my car @ ~15amps, the cord was not at all warm which is no surprise considering the cord is rated for 30A.
